03

Composition / Information on Ingredients

Chemical components, concentration ranges, and hazardous substance identification

Type mixture
Chemical Name CAS Number Concentration Hazardous
Nickel 7440-02-0 60 - 80% Yes
Formaldehyde, polymer with a-(2-aminomethylethyl)-w-(2-aminomethylethoxy)poly[oxy(methyl-1,2-ethanediyl)]; (chlormethyl)oxirane, 4,4 2065257-03-4 10 - 30% Yes
Butyl diethylene glycol acetate 124-17-4 5 - 10% Yes
Epichlorohydrin-4,4'-isopropylidene diphenol resin 25068-38-6 1 - 5% Yes
Bisphenol-F Epichlorhydrin resin 9003-36-5 1 - 5% Yes
Diuron 330-54-1 1 - 5% Yes
Nickel oxide 1313-99-1 0.1 - 1% Yes
N-(3-(Trimethoxysilyl)propyl)ethylenediamine 1760-24-3 0.1 - 1% Yes

Notes

* Exact percentages may vary or are trade secret. Concentration range is provided to assist users in providing appropriate protections.

04

First Aid Measures

Emergency procedures for chemical exposure incidents

Inhalation

Move to fresh air. If not breathing, give artificial respiration. If breathing is difficult, give oxygen. Get medical attention.

Skin contact

Immediately flush skin with plenty of water (using soap, if available). Remove contaminated clothing and footwear. If symptoms develop and persist, get medical attention. Wash clothing before reuse. Thoroughly clean shoes before reuse.

Eye contact

Rinse immediately with plenty of water, also under the eyelids, for at least 15 minutes. Get medical attention.

Ingestion

DO NOT induce vomiting unless directed to do so by medical personnel. Never give anything by mouth to an unconscious person. Get medical attention.

Immediate Medical Attention

Get medical attention.

Handling and Storage

Safe handling precautions, storage conditions, and workplace requirements

Handling

Prevent contact with eyes, skin and clothing. Do not breathe vapor and mist. Wash thoroughly after handling. Use only with adequate ventilation. Keep container closed.

Storage

Store between -25 °C (-13°F) and -18 °C (0.4 °F) Keep container tightly closed and in a cool, well-ventilated place away from incompatible materials. Keep away from heat, spark and flame. Protect from direct sunlight.

Hygiene

Wash thoroughly after handling.

Fire prevention

Keep away from heat, spark and flame.
